Output 23c85f839ccb51212468a554c24a851fae2009e5b628d49737684b5873007aff:1

value
101994575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3916e4a2d884ca4ea346fd8e87ef6e79cbba08ea OP_EQUALVERIFY OP_CHECKSIG
address
16CrwaNx8vWeutgQ6jmdNZcBGefjJmv5YT
transaction
23c85f839ccb51212468a554c24a851fae2009e5b628d49737684b5873007aff
spent
true